Exterior Painting in Longmont, CO
Exterior painting services involve applying fresh coats of paint to the exterior surfaces of residential properties, including siding, trim, doors, and shutters. These projects typically aim to enhance curb appeal, provide protection against weather elements, and extend the lifespan of building materials. Homeowners often request exterior painting when preparing to sell, updating the look of their home, or addressing areas that have become faded, chipped, or weathered over time.
Before requesting exterior painting services, property owners usually want to understand the scope of work, including surface preparation, types of paint used, and any necessary repairs to siding or trim. It's also helpful to consider the condition of existing paint, the preferred color schemes, and any specific finishes or textures desired. Clear communication about these details can help ensure the project meets expectations and results in a durable, attractive finish.

Exterior Painting Questions
What types of exterior surfaces can be painted? Exterior painting services typically cover siding, stucco, wood, brick, and trim to enhance curb appeal and protect the surface.
Are there certain times of year best for exterior painting? The ideal time for exterior painting is during mild, dry weather to ensure proper drying and adhesion of the paint.
What preparation is needed before painting? Proper preparation includes cleaning surfaces, scraping loose paint, sanding rough areas, and priming to ensure a smooth, durable finish.
Can exterior painting improve the value of a property? Yes, a fresh coat of paint can boost curb appeal and potentially increase property value by making the exterior look well-maintained.
